How is ideal weight calculated?

Traditionally, a person’s ideal weight was calculated based on a rule of thumb approach, instead of a research-based or population-study-based approach. It gave the ideal weight according to height and the following formulae were used in traditional weight calculators:

  • Ideal body weight (men) = 50 kg + 1.9 kg for every inch above 5 feet
  • Ideal body weight (women) = 49 kg + 1.7 kg for every inch above 5 feet

However, modern studies show that the traditional method shows results that correlate with Body Mass Index (BMI) values, with 21 for women and 22.5 for men. The healthy BMI for men and women is between the range of 18.5 and 24.9, with 22 being right in the middle.

Ideal weight for children

Determining if a child has a healthy weight for their height and age is not very easy. They tend to be the healthiest when they are at a certain range of weight. One can use an ideal weight calculator that is designed for children.

This is the general method to calculate ideal weight for a child:

  • Ideal weight for infants (< 12 months) = (age in months + 9)/2
  • Ideal weight for children (1-5 years) = 2 x (age in years + 5)
  • Ideal weight for children (5-14 years) = 4 x age in years.

How to calculate waist to height ratio?

One can calculate their waist to height ratio by dividing the size of the waist by the height. If you have a waist measurement that is less than half of that of your height, then it is very likely that you aren’t at risk of any obesity-based disease.

Studies have shown that having more belly fat can lead to heart-diseases. So, it is useful to measure the waist to hip ratio. Here, you measure the size of the waist at its narrowest area (which is usually just above the belly button). Then you measure the hip at its widest area. Then divide the hip measurement by the waist measurement. You can refer to a chart for the ideal values.

Calories for weight gain/weight loss

Generally, one must eat more calories than you burn in order to gain weight. For people who desire to put on weight slowly, they can eat 300 to 500 calories over what they usually eat. Those who want to gain weight quickly should eat around 700 to 1000 calories every day.

If you are trying to lose weight, then you can calculate your calorie needs currently, and then remove 500 to 1000 calories each day. This will cause you to lose around half a kg to 1 kg every week. However, you must ensure that you don’t eat less than 1200 calories per day if you are a woman, and 1800 calories per day if you are a man.

Ideal weight with body fat percentage

A person’s weight is the sum total of their lean mass and their body fat. Lean body mass weighs roughly around 60 to 90% of your body weight.

It is possible to find out the amount of weight you need to shed to reach a lower body fat percentage. It can be determined by the following formula:

  • Desired weight = lean weight/(100% - desired body fat%)

How is medical weight calculated? ›

Body Mass Index is a simple calculation using a person's height and weight. The formula is BMI = kg/m2 where kg is a person's weight in kilograms and m2 is their height in metres squared. A BMI of 25.0 or more is overweight, while the healthy range is 18.5 to 24.9. BMI applies to most adults 18-65 years.

How is weight category calculated? ›

Body mass index (BMI) is a person's weight in kilograms divided by the square of height in meters. BMI is an inexpensive and easy screening method for weight category—underweight, healthy weight, overweight, and obesity.

What is ideal body weight in medicine? ›

Normal ideal body weight (IBW) for patients can be calculated by the formulas21: Healthy males: 106 lb for initial 5 feet, plus 6 lb for every inch over 5 feet, plus 10% if over 50 years old. Healthy females: 100 lb for initial 5 feet, plus 5 lb for every inch over 5 feet, plus 10% if older than 50 years.

Is ideal weight affected by age? ›

Older adults tend to lose muscle and bone, so more of their body weight is likely to come from fat. Younger people and athletes may weigh more due to strong muscles and denser bones. These realities can skew your BMI number and make it less accurate for predicting exact body fat levels.

What is the perfect waist size for a woman? ›

What should your waist measurement be? For men, a waist circumference below 94cm (37in) is 'low risk', 94–102cm (37-40in) is 'high risk' and more than 102cm (40in) is 'very high'. For women, below 80cm (31.5in) is low risk, 80–88cm (31.5-34.6in) is high risk and more than 88cm (34.6in) is very high.

Why do we calculate ideal body weight? ›

Ideal body weight, or lean body weight, is used in clinical settings to calculate safe drug dosages. Some health professionals choose to use it in clinical or office settings to provide patients and clients with weight gain and weight loss goals based on their height.
